iwanta34gtr Posted June 1, 2012 Author Share Posted June 1, 2012 (edited) Hi All, Part 4 - New GTR badges are now on. The front one just had two screws holding it on. The rear one had double sided tape on it, which was a pain to remove. With the rear, first thing I did was take exact measurements of the badge placement. Then used fishing line to harmlessly cut through the old tape behind the old badge and then removed the residue with my fingers and alot of rubbing and peeling. A bit of Eucalyptus oil on a rag also helped here. This was followed by masking up the area around where the old badge was (to ensure the badge placement was completely accurate), then compounded the required area with Meguiars Ultimate Compound for clean up. New badge was then applied and then afterwards, the area was polished with Meguiars Ultimate Polish and then waxed with Meguiars Ultimate Liquid Wax. It was done in this order as I believe it is not recommended to apply stickers or badges to a freshly waxed / polished surface as they can move when exposed to sun - etc. Cheers. iwanta34gtr Posted July 23, 2012 Author Share Posted July 23, 2012 (edited) Update. The Meguiars 'Ultimate' products which were applied at the start of this thread are still holding up well. Dedicated some time towards cleaning her engine bay. No real tricks here, started with degreasing and hosing out the whole area (After covering required items - air box, alarm, AFM's - etc) avoiding electrical areas and valley cover. Required materials - 1) Degreaser and standard hose with spray nozzle 2) Autosol and microfibre cloths for metal polishing 3) Mothers powerball for hard to reach areas 4) Meguiars ultimate compound for painted surfaces 5) A few hours worth of blood, sweat and tears Pics attached. iwanta34gtr Posted July 25, 2012 Author Share Posted July 25, 2012 How does the rainX stuff go on removing watermarks on glass? I've tried a lot and i cant seem to get rid of the ones on my rear window? I have used RainX Xtreme Clean polish on a few of my previous cars to remove the majority of hard glass water marks. If you looked very closely from certain angles, you could still see a few of them - however it definately brought back the clarity and reflections. iwanta34gtr Posted August 6, 2012 Author Share Posted August 6, 2012 Windscreen wipers. Sound exciting yeah? As this has turned in to a bit more of a 'blog', thought i'd post my endeavours over the weekend, as exciting as they may be. My windscreen wiper arms were a little worse for wear - with rust, scratches and discolouration all over them. Structurally, they were 100% so I decided to spend some time restoring them. The process - 1) Sanded down the surface with wet and dry sand paper - 800 grit, 1200 grit, 2000 grit 2) Spent alot of extra time around the parts which had rusted - ensuring the surface was 100% smooth 3) Cleaned the surface with water and microfibre cloths, prep for painting 4) Popped the screw caps off the bottom of the arms, as they still looked brand new and didnt require painting 5) Started the masking process, lots of newspaper and 3M blue tape 7) Left the spray can out in the sun for a good 15 minutes+ to let it heat up and spray easily 6) Applied 10 thin and even coats of heat resistant 'flat black' paint, sourced from Bunnings For something so visible through the windscreen - I'm very happy with the result. Plan on doing the same to my rear wiper next weekend. Some before and after shots attached below. Cheers.
